    How to Learn a New Language with Babbel

    Babbel teaches real conversations in Spanish, French, German, Italian, and 11 other languages through short, structured lessons designed for adults.

    1

    Download Babbel and pick a language

    ~17s
    Download the Babbel app from the App Store or Google Play, or visit babbel.com on a computer. Tap "Get Started" and choose the language you want to learn. Babbel will ask your reason for learning (travel, family, work, etc.) and your current level (complete beginner, some prior experience).
    2

    Start the free trial

    ~22s
    Babbel offers a 20-day free trial. Tap "Try Free" to begin — you don't need to enter a credit card. This gives you access to the first course in your chosen language. After the trial, a subscription is required to continue.

    Quick Tip

    If you prefer a completely free option, Duolingo offers basic language learning at no cost. Babbel's paid model goes deeper into grammar and practical phrases.

    3

    Take your first lesson

    ~23s
    Each lesson starts by introducing vocabulary through pictures and audio. You'll hear a native speaker say a word, see its spelling, and then practice using it in short exercises — matching, fill-in-the-blank, and speaking practice. Lessons are 10-15 minutes and can be paused at any time.

    Quick Tip

    Turn on the speaking exercises (microphone icon) so you can practice pronunciation. Babbel will tell you when your pronunciation is close to correct.

    4

    Build a daily habit

    ~15s
    Set a daily reminder in the app (tap ProfileNotifications) to study at the same time each day. Even 10 minutes a day adds up quickly. Tap the trophy icon to track your streak — seeing your progress motivates you to keep going.
    5

    Explore different course types

    ~15s
    After finishing beginner lessons, explore Babbel's other content: podcasts in your target language, grammar review courses, and themed vocabulary sets (travel phrases, food vocabulary, business language). Tap "Learn" at the bottom of the screen and scroll to see all available content.

    Babbel is a language-learning app available on iPhone, Android, and the web. It offers courses in 14 languages including Spanish, French, German, Italian, Portuguese, Dutch, Polish, Swedish, Turkish, and more.

    Unlike Duolingo, which uses a game-based format, Babbel focuses on practical conversation skills you'll actually use — ordering food at a restaurant, asking for directions, talking with a doctor, or chatting with family. Lessons are taught by linguistics experts and typically take 10-15 minutes each, making them ideal for fitting into a daily routine.

    Babbel teaches pronunciation by having you record yourself and comparing your speech to native speaker audio. It also uses spaced repetition — a proven technique that shows you vocabulary again right before you'd normally forget it.

    The app costs $13.95/month or $83.40/year (about $7/month). There's a 20-day free trial with no credit card required. Unlike some apps, Babbel gives you access to all lessons in a language at once — you're not locked into a path.

    Research from City University of New York found that 15 hours of Babbel equals a full college semester of Spanish instruction. It's particularly well-reviewed by adult learners returning to language study.
